US ZIP Code 70546 Historical Population Data
| Year | Median Age | Population |
|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 37.9 | 15,242 |
| 2023 | 36.3 | 15,821 |
| 2022 | 36.0 | 16,526 |
| 2021 | 36.1 | 16,428 |

Dependency Ratios for US ZIP Code 70546
- Total Dependency Ratio:
- 80.4
- Youth Dependency:
- 46.4
- Old-Age Dependency:
- 33.9
The dependency ratio measures dependents (ages 0-17 and 65+) per 100 working-age individuals (ages 18-64).
